The 2000 Rauzan-Ségla is a Bordeaux Blend hailing from the Margaux sub-region in Bordeaux, France. This vintage is notably robust, with an alcohol content of 15.0%, and is sealed with a cork closure. The wine is characterized by its deep red color and complex bouquet, offering a blend of primary and secondary aromas.

Neal Martin's Wine Journal praises the wine with a score of 95, describing it as "fleshy" with notes of cranberry, strawberry, and fig, complemented by secondary aromas like saddle leather and Provençal herbs. Martin notes the wine's "silky smooth tannins" and its transformation from a "masculine and broody" youth to a more approachable maturity, predicting it will drink well from 2013 to 2040.

Vinous also commends the wine, giving it a score of 93. Neal Martin highlights its "grainy tannins and tarry black fruit," providing a structured and fresh palate that leads to a "grippy, saline finish."

Wine Enthusiast awarded it a 94, observing that initially, the wine presents as more "new world" than Bordeaux but eventually reveals "subtle, perfumed aromas" and "structured fruit" with "clean acidity."

James Suckling gave it a score of 93, noting the presence of "tobacco, plums and currants," with a palate that transitions from "tobacco and chocolate" to "coffee and fruit."

Decanter, giving a score of 94, remarks on its "notes of woodsmoke, cigar box, leather, hickory and exotic spices," and considers it a wine that "will go the distance."

Jeb Dunnuck describes it as a "mature yet balanced wine," giving it a score of 94 for its "complexity," "seamless texture," and "great finish."

The reviews collectively suggest that the 2000 Rauzan-Ségla is a well-structured and complex wine, with the ability to age gracefully for many years.
